I have an ABIT NF7S, I had it stable at 212x8.5 my cpu can't handle anymore speed! so in order to get a few more 3dmarks I decided to play with the agp speed the other day, I got it all the way up to 80 Mhz I figure pci is at 40! and everything was stable! but now I have no sound , I tried putting the sound card in 4 and 6 speaker mode and sound comes out of everyother connector except the middle one! its weird, windows detects sound the nforce panel sound bars move when i lay an mp3 just no sound coming from the connector. what's goin on? have I killed something by upping the AGP/PCI? I tried some headphones and no sound either, so I know its not the speakers!!!!

It's possible, through all of the changes, the BIOS was corrupted. May want to get a ABIT NF7-S nForce2 BIOS Survival Kit (http://www.excaliberpc.com/product_info.php?cPath=156_157&products_id=918) if ya have version 1.2.

AGP and PCI are independent for nforce2. The PCI was at 33MHz.

South bridge being cooled? Alot of people experience USB/Mouse/Keyboard/Sound probs if sb isnt being cooled.
